- Nikolajsen LundeFeb 02, 2026 · 4 months agoWhen it comes to using Venmo for cash advances with Capital One, there are a few fees that you should be aware of. First, there is a cash advance fee charged by Capital One, which is typically a percentage of the amount you withdraw. Additionally, Venmo may also charge a fee for using their service to make cash advances. It's important to check with both Capital One and Venmo to understand the specific fees associated with this type of transaction.
